Output e3cb0734aa8436f50bc918f9cc9fb4a295a1d7c44e6fcb31984db13af20cabee:19

value
14500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aecbb65d739adf4dc6bd6c34fe4942e39a1c26b5 OP_EQUAL
address
A8NWGx8iQtBEejRbxuf2T67KyUDZqaHp3T
transaction
e3cb0734aa8436f50bc918f9cc9fb4a295a1d7c44e6fcb31984db13af20cabee